Location
London

About The Role

FDM is a global business and technology consultancy seeking a React Developer to work for our client within the finance sector. This is initially a 12-month contract with the potential to extend and will be a hybrid role that will be based in London.

Our client is looking for a React Developer with JavaScript or TypeScript to join the EMEA Euclid development team; a small, but highly experienced and cohesive team that operates within a global group of talented developers spanning multiple regions. The individual will primarily focus on the new UI rewrite project – a new web-based replacement for the long-standing WinForms C# front-end application. The UI is built using React with TypeScript so experience of this framework is essential.

The existing backend is a SOA stack written in C# and so any experience of this technology would be welcomed. This is an excellent opportunity for an ambitious developer who wants to be a part of a new project that will have a direct impact to the business.

Responsibilities

  • Participate in the design, development and roll-out of the new UI to the business
  • Work with BA/PM or end users to gather and review user requirements, provide suggestions on design and enhancements
  • Follow global development/change management standards to deliver quality enhancements/solutions in a timely manner
  • Participate in development, code reviews and post mortem activities within global team
  • Be a good team player to ensure a cohesive culture to effectively solve local/global business problems while building a strategic platform for Global Equities

About You

Requirements

  • Bachelor’s degree or higher, ideally in computer science or engineering
  • 5+ years of hands-on Web development experience with React and JavaScript/TypeScript
  • Practical experience of implementing and working with advanced state management techniques, including Redux, as well as expertise in handling asynchronous operations using Epics, Observables, and RxJS libraries
  • Familiarity with cross-browser and inter-process communication technologies, including but not limited to Electron for desktop applications, Web Broadcast Channels for browser-to-browser messaging, and custom IPC (Inter-Process Communication) systems for desktop environments
  • Knowledge of SharedWorkers – usage and implementation
  • Knowledge of integrating and consuming RESTful web APIs and implementing real-time communication through WebSocket streaming, utilising HTTP and WebSocket protocols
  • Expertise in handling JSON data formats and custom serialization methods for both request-response and streaming scenarios
  • Demonstrates resilience and adaptability in high-pressure environments, consistently delivering high-quality work within stringent deadlines

 

About Us

Why join us

  • Career coaching, mentoring and access to upskilling throughout your entire FDM career
  • Assignments with global companies and opportunities to work abroad
  • Opportunity to re-skill and up-skill into new areas, develop non-linear career paths and build a skillset within your field
  • Annual leave, work-place pension and BAYE share scheme

About FDM

We are a business and technology consultancy and one of the UK's leading employers, recruiting the brightest talent to become the innovators of tomorrow. We have centres across Europe, North America and Asia-Pacific, and a global workforce of over 3,500 Consultants. FDM has shown exponential growth throughout the years, firmly establishing itself as an award-winning employer and is listed on the FTSE4Good Index.

Diversity and Inclusion

FDM Group is an equal opportunity employer, and all qualified applicants will receive consideration for employment without regard to race, colour, religion, sex, sexual orientation, national origin, age, disability, veteran status or any other status protected by federal, provincial or local laws.

Other jobs like this

Location
London
Location
UK
Location
London